Trichnella does not pass through the lungs during its life cycle. The other three pass through the lungs as a pa of their life cycle. They cause Loffler's syndrome - in which eosinophils accumilate in the lungs in response to parasitic infection. Strongyloides can also cause Loffler's syndrome.
